Default Wedding Etiquette

My brother is getting married in a month, and I just cannot believe the lack of courtesy that some people have when invited to a wedding.

Within 2 days of sending out the invitations, they received 6 or 7 phone calls from single people asking if they could bring a date. The bride and groom are trying to keep costs down, and don't want to pay for extraneous people that they don't know. One relative got so bent out of shape he said he won't even go to the wedding if he can't bring someone. Then his MOTHER called my dad to throw a fit about the whole thing, and now she's threatening not to come because her son can't bring a guest. Really?


I always just thought it was common courtesy/knowledge that if the invitation does not indicate "& guest", then you were invited solo. I have never, and would never, call the bride and groom and ask them otherwise. Is my thinking outdated?
